FOLLOWING a highly successful global tour, Bluey, Bingo, Mum and Dad will soon be headed to Bendigo as part of a massive Australian tour.

Ulumbarra Theatre will host Bluey’s Big Play The Stage Show on both 18 and 19 July.

Ahead of the much-loved Heeler family’s arrival, some of the show’s most important VIPs, including the Bluey stage puppet, her personal puppeteer Julia Landberg, and the show’s director of puppetry Jacob Williams paid a visit to the goldfields region in recent days.

Featuring larger than life, cleverly crafted puppets, the theatrical adaptation of the award-winning children’s television series is packed with music, laughter, and fun for the whole family, Landberg and Williams said.

“When Bluey skips onto the stage she gets a massive cheer from the audience, it’s quite special,” said Landberg.

Williams said the show has introduced audiences around the world to some uniquely Aussie terms.

“Bluey is very much an ambassador and the culture around the show is just a real joy,” he said.

Audiences of all ages will get to see Bluey, Bingo, Chilli and Bandit as they’ve never seen them before, as Bluey and the family embark on this unique live show adventure that has delighted audiences across the globe.

With an original story by Bluey creator Joe Brumm, and music by Bluey composer Joff Bush, it will be Bluey, ‘for real life’.

Since premiering in Australia in 2020, Bluey’s Big Play The Stage Show has toured across the UK, Ireland, Canada, the US, Europe, Singapore, South Africa and the UAE and has been seen by millions of fans.

“After an incredible journey touring around the world, we’re beyond excited to bring Bluey’s Big Play home to Australian audiences,” said Sharon Wilson, director of brands and licensing BBC Studios ANZ.

“The love for Bluey continues to grow, and we can’t wait for families around the country to experience the joy, laughter and heart of this special live show, right here on home soil,” Wilson said.
